Recently I've discovered this fitness trainer/person on Facebook called Joseph Rackich Fitness and he says you need to consume 1g of protein per LEAN body weight. But Ive always thought you consume 1g of protein per pound of bodyweight in general? So I'd like to know which one is correct.
7.1K Post(s)Gender: MaleGoal: BodybuildingDate Joined: August 8, 2008
Posted
Hey Joel!
Well, this is not an exact science! Different people react to different amounts of protein differently.
What this means is that you need to figure out what works for you. Having said that I recommend that you start with 1 gram of protein per pound of bodyweight.
So if you weigh 156lbs (71kg), start with at least 160 grams of protein. If you are relavtively lean (10-15% BF), it'll be pretty similar to your LEAN bodyweight so it doesn't really matter.
However, why not be safe and not take any risks? Getting in 150-200 grams of protein is fairly easy, so aim for that!
